Supported by the OncoNormandie Regional Cancerology Network and initiated by the Caen Normandie University Hospital in 2016, “Normandie Sporte contre le Cancer” is an event promoting Adapted Physical Activity ( APA ) for therapeutic purposes for people with cancer .

The benefits of APA

The positive impacts of the APA intervene in the 3 levels of cancer prevention allowing:

  • limit the appearance of the disease (primary prevention)
  • fight against the adverse effects of the disease and its treatments (secondary prevention)
  • limit the risks of recurrence (tertiary prevention)

The goal is therefore to raise public awareness of the benefits of a healthy lifestyle and to provide information on the benefits of physical activity in preventing cancer. Practicing appropriate physical activity on a regular basis is essential. According to studies carried out on certain types of cancer, appropriate physical activity in cancer patients reduces fatigue (30%), improves quality of life, or even reduces the risk of recurrence (up to 40%).
